allow most header files to be compiled separately
* build-aux/mk-opts.pl: Include <limits> in generated header files.
* file-io.h, ls-hdf5.h, ls-mat-ascii.h, ls-mat4.h, ls-mat5.h,
ls-oct-binary.h, ls-oct-text.h, ls-utils.h, mxarray.in.h,
octave-link.h, octave-preserve-stream-state.h, pt-check.h,
pt-tm-const.h, DAERTFunc.h, aepbalance.h, eigs-base.h,
Sparse-diag-op-defs.h, Sparse-op-defs.h, Sparse-perm-op-defs.h,
action-container.h, oct-rl-edit.h, url-transfer.h:
Include additional headers or use forward declarations to allow
successful compilation of the file by itself.

If not, see <http://www.gnu.org/licenses/>. */ #if ! defined (octave_ls_mat5_h) #define octave_ls_mat5_h 1 #include "octave-config.h" #include <iosfwd> #include <string> class octave_value; enum mat5_data_type { miINT8 = 1, // 8 bit signed miUINT8, // 8 bit unsigned miINT16, // 16 bit signed miUINT16, // 16 bit unsigned miINT32, // 32 bit signed miUINT32, // 32 bit unsigned miSINGLE, // IEEE 754 single precision float miRESERVE1, miDOUBLE, // IEEE 754 double precision float miRESERVE2, miRESERVE3, miINT64, // 64 bit signed miUINT64, // 64 bit unsigned miMATRIX, // MATLAB array miCOMPRESSED, // Compressed data miUTF8, // Unicode UTF-8 Encoded Character Data miUTF16, // Unicode UTF-16 Encoded Character Data miUTF32 // Unicode UTF-32 Encoded Character Data }; extern int read_mat5_binary_file_header (std::istream& is, bool& swap, bool quiet = false, const std::string& filename = ""); extern std::string read_mat5_binary_element (std::istream& is, const std::string& filename, bool swap, bool& global, octave_value& tc); extern bool save_mat5_binary_element (std::ostream& os, const octave_value& tc, const std::string& name, bool mark_as_global, bool mat7_format, bool save_as_floats, bool compressing = false); #endif
